Rohit Sharma is set to sit out for a long time and might only make a comeback for the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2020 that starts on March 29. As per a report in The Times of India, Sharma had already asked for a rest for the South Africa ODIs and the calf issue has now ruled him out of home series.

Rohit suffered the calf issue during the fifth T20I against New Zealand on Sunday. He continued to bat for a while before walking off the field. It is to be noted that he has suffered the same problem on a few occasions.

His absence from ODIs and Tests is a big blow for Men in Blue but India do not play a T20I till June. Hence, the team management can try out new players in the ODI series. Mayank Agarwal and Prithvi Shaw have been confirmed to open the innings in the ODIs against New Zealand. One of them will also keep his spot for South Africa ODIs due Rohit’s unavailability – Shikhar Dhawan is expected to be fit by then.
For Test matches, Rohit’s absence saw Shaw make his comeback into the squad after more than a year. Although he isn’t a confirmed selection in playing XI as Shubman Gill is above him in the pecking order.

Meanwhile, hosts New Zealand also suffered a big blow as their captain Kane Williamson has been ruled out of first two ODIs due to shoulder injury. The right-handed batsman had suffered the issue during third T20I against India and was forced to miss the last two T20Is.

The three-match ODI series kicks off on February 5 while the Test starts on February 21.
Past occasion of Rohit missing out due to thigh issue
In 2016/17, Rohit sat out of for more than four months due to a thigh issue that he suffered in the final ODI against New Zealand. He played a couple of games for Mumbai before returning for IPL 2017. Rohit was also recalled for ICC Champions Trophy 2017 soon after.
